Abstract

PARTÍCULAS DE PIGMENTO EM NANOESCALA DE QUINACRIDONA. A presente invenção refere-se a uma composição de partícula de pigmento em nanoescala que inclui um pigmento de quinacridona incluindo pelo menos uma porção funcional e um composto estabilizante estericamente denso incluindo pelo menos um grupo funcional, em que a porção funcional se associa não covalentemente com o grupo funcional; e a presença do estabilizante associado limita a extensão de crescimento e agregação de partícula, para proporcionar partículas com tamanho de nanoescala.
